Sheesh: I have both the purple skirt and the iris TSV jacket and I agree with JJM. It's an "interesting" contrast. I don't wear them together. I've come to the boards over the years begging for advice on what to wear with the purple boho. It sits in my closet unused too much of the time because there were never any easy pairings from Linea that came out at the time the purple skirt came out. And Louis warned at some length about mixing your purples - something about red based purples and some other color based purples..... I usually opt for a contrast (white, soft yellow) rather than a coordinating piece because the differences in the zillion "purple" tones can be substantial - especially in bright sun light. I tend to wear my bohos in the heat of the summer - hence bright sun light. I like it paired with some soft lavender pieces I've acquired - all not Linea.

Wanted to share what top to wear with the violet boho skirt (A224718). I wear the Animal Print Blazer in Lavender (A201016). The jacket color is a shade or so lighter than the violet boho, but coordinates nicely. Have purchased other Linea tops in violet/lavender, but those are not available, such as a sllk blouse and the multi-color silk window pane jacket. Pink is also a good choice, but sometimes I'm not in the pink mood.

The butter hydrangea top looks great with the purple boho, along with the same colorway in the matching jacket (no longer available), with a coordinating solid purple tank, which I have from Chicos. You know, their spring/summer sleeveless cotton ribbed tanks. I did see a butter hydrangea jacket on the bay very recently, so if you don't have this jacket, check it out!

I also wear the white georgette blouse and tank over the purple boho, and tie it together with purple jewelry.

Have fun with this boho! It is really very versatile!
